About Tavern Talk 2: Dreamwalker
Tavern Talk 2: Dreamwalker is a single player casual simulation game with fantasy and anime themes. It was developed by Gentle Troll Entertainment and was released on June 9, 2026. It received very positive reviews from players.
What to expect?This is not a management game! ✨ A new standalone game in the Tavern Talk universe! ♀️ Play the tavern owner. D&D-inspired visual novel with 8 unique characters. ️ LGBTQ+ positive representation. Immersive reading of at least 12 hours on your first playthrough. Branching narrative, meaningful choices and three unique endings. Casual drink mixing and quest bui…

Reviews
- Beautiful and cozy art style with lovely character designs and backgrounds that create a warm atmosphere.
- Engaging and meaningful character-driven story with a mix of new and returning characters, fostering emotional connections and diverse personalities.
- Improved and more complex drink mixing and quest systems offering a rewarding challenge for players who enjoy puzzle-like gameplay and strategic thinking.
- Drink mixing system is more complicated and less intuitive than the original, leading to frustration and reliance on external guides.
- Smaller and less dynamic cast of characters compared to the first game, with some characters feeling one-dimensional and fewer quests to explore.
- Player choices feel less impactful on the story and overall game outcome, resulting in a diminished sense of agency and a more passive protagonist.
story
69 mentions Positive Neutral NegativeThe story of this game is praised for its charming characters, captivating plot, and increased complexity in drink mixing and quest creation, which offer players meaningful agency and multiple narrative paths. However, some users find it shorter and somewhat rushed compared to the original, with fewer quests and a less impactful choice system, while others appreciate its more mature themes and cozy yet dramatic tone. Overall, it is enjoyable and immersive, especially for fans of the first game, but some feel it lacks the depth and worldbuilding that made the predecessor standout.
